Resumo: E-therapy aims to provide therapy sessions through recent communication mediums (internet) between patients and therapists. eSchi is an e-Therapy tool currently being developed by the authors and will work as a complement to traditional rehabilitation and training practices, It has distinct modules and the patient module, here described, will have patients as their primary actors. These patients have special psychiatric conditions that imply special attention and considerations both in the design and implementation phases of the software. In order to provide the ideal tool for its target audience, previous to the delivery, a test phase was conducted. In the test phase, both a beta test and heuristic evaluations were made. Tests results showed the lack of some significant aspects that were then corrected and a new version of the tool was produced.
